Notes: (All information dates back to 1999) Concordia (Ore.) earns the No. 1 ranking for the third-straight week and 13th all-time ... Lindsey Wilson (Ky.) owns the most No. 1 rankings all-time with 41, followed by former NAIA member Azusa Pacific (Calif.) (33), Westmont (Calif.) (19), Concordia (13), Lee (Tenn.) (11) and Martin Methodist (10) ... Lindsey Wilson owns the longest current active streak of consecutive appearances in the Top 25 with 141 ... Concordia (120) and Lee (102) are the only other programs to occupy a spot in the poll 100-or-more consecutive weeks ... The Blue Raiders also lead the way with consecutive weeks at No. 1 with 13, spanning the 2004 - 2005 seasons ... The 2011 Lee squad is the first team to start and end the season at No. 1 ... William Carey's No. 10 rating on Sept. 18 marked the first time the Crusaders have been in the top-10 since Sept. 6, 2011 (No. 7) ... No. 25 Ashford (Iowa) is making its first appearance ... Seven of the top-10 teams have been ranked in the top-10 in every poll this season.
